Dave & Buster’s Entertainment, Inc. owns and operates entertainment and dining venues under the Dave & Buster’s name in North America. Its locations offer food and beverage menus and a range of game- and TV/event-focused attractions, serving adults and families.

Understand Dave & Buster's Entertainment, Inc.: how it makes money

Dave & Buster's Entertainment operates adult and family entertainment and dining venues in North America that earn revenue from selling food and beverages and from games and watching live sports and other televised events.

The profit engine is store performance, where revenue depends on comparable store sales driven by guest activity across dining, games, and live sports programming, rather than only by adding new locations.
